Output 1e10335143c1232080538e77574cd6401f61b6d71ae3b8c0222fe8265ae6cbfb:0

value
69308
script pubkey
OP_0 OP_PUSHBYTES_20 df08c76bf512912fc32c666dcff265db7a5ca853
address
bc1qmuyvw6l4z2gjlsevvekulun9mda9e2znajjfgz
transaction
1e10335143c1232080538e77574cd6401f61b6d71ae3b8c0222fe8265ae6cbfb
confirmations
256023
spent
true